     White Chili

Category   Salads - Soups - Sidedishes
Sub Category   Low-fat
Servings   6 ( 1 1/3 cup each)
Preptime   1 hour

Ingredients
1 tbs. canola oil
1 1/2 cups chopped onion
2 4-ounce cans chopped green chiles
1 tsp. dried oregano
1 tsp. ground cumin
1/8-1/4 tsp. cayenne pepper
3 15-ounce cans great northern beans, rinsed
4 cups reduced-sodium chicken broth
4 cups diced cooked skinless turkey or chicken
 
2 tbs. cider vinegar

Instructions
Heat o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add onion; cook, stirring occasionally, until softened, about 5 minutes. Stir in chiles, oregano, cumin and cayenne. Cook, stirring occasionally, for 5 minutes. Stir in beans and broth; bring to a simmer. Cook Stirring occasionally, for 20 minutes. Add turkey (or chicken) and vinegar; cook for 5 minutes more. Serve.
Per serving- 453 calories; 7 g fat (2 g sat, 2 g mono); 68 mg cholesterol; 52 g carbohydrate; 47 g protein; 11 g fiber; 215 mg sodium. Nutritional Bonus- Niacin (80% DV), Fiber (45% DV), Vitamin C (30% DV), Iron (25% DV)
Option- Throw all ingredients in a crock pot and simmer for 4 to 5 hours.
Serving Suggestions
Serve as soup or over rice.
